1. Unexplained Water Stains
Water stains on walls or ceilings in your home can indicate serious underlying issues. If you notice brown or yellowish spots forming, itβs essential to investigate further. In Parker, these stains might stem from roof leaks exacerbated by hail damage or ice dams. Plan on spending around $200-$500 for a professional service to identify and address the source.
2. Increased Humidity Levels
Your indoor humidity should ideally be between 30% to 50%. If your air quality measures read higher, this could indicate dampness resulting from water intrusion. Consider this especially after heavy rain or snowmelt. Servicing a humid home may cost around $150 for dehumidification equipment and consultation.
3. Sagging Walls or Ceilings
Sagging walls or ceilings are a clear sign of moisture issues, often linked to leaks or flooding. If you feel like your home is 'listening,' it's perhaps time to seek professional help. Correcting this problem could range from $500 to over $2,000, depending on the extent of the damage.
4. Mold Growth
Seeing mold indoors, especially in bathrooms or basements, is never a good sign. Mold thrives in humid, damp conditions and can pose health risks. In Parker, remediation can range from $500 to $6,000, depending on the area affected and the materials involved.
5. Odors of Dampness or Decay
Do you notice a musty smell in your home? Undetected leaks can cause wet wood and damp carpets, leading to unpleasant odors. Consult a professional for inspection, costing about $150-$300, to rule out hidden issues.
6. Visible Cracks in Walls or Foundation
Cracks, particularly horizontal ones near basement walls, indicate potential structural damage due to water infiltration. Repairing these cracks could range anywhere from $500 to $2,500, depending on the severity. Early intervention can save you from catastrophic failure.

How long does the restoration process take?
The time it takes hinges on various factorsβtypically from a few days to several weeks, depending on the extent of damage and materials involved.
Is it necessary to replace flooring after water damage?
If water seeps into flooring materials, replacement is often necessary, especially with carpet and laminate due to potential mold growth.
How can I prevent water damage in my home?
Regular maintenance of gutters, increasing the slope away from foundations, and ensuring proper drainage can greatly mitigate water damage risks.
